About the Role:

 

Cyderes is looking for a Financial Analyst (FA) to join our growing Financial Planning & Analysis (FP&A) team. This is an exciting opportunity to join a growing company in a expanding Cybersecurity industry. The FA will prepare reports for partners across the organization to "explain the story behind the numbers". Reporting to the Manager FP&A, the FA will have wide exposure to multiple stages of the business and special projects across the organization.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are material, reports, and ad-hoc analysis to be presented to the highest levels.
  • Help create financial reporting in a manner clear to non-financial partners.
  • Conduct basic ad-hoc analysis to address concerns or answers queries generated by management.
  • Help prepare the annual budget and periodic forecasts.
  • Distribute standard periodic internal reporting across the organization.
  • Help accomplish special projects within Finance.
  • Help implement projects within finance to create efficiencies, improve reporting, incorporate automation/best practices.

Requirements

  • Complete assigned analyses end-to-end with weekly check-ins rather than daily direction
  • Explain financial results (variances, forecasts, margins) to sales, HR, and operations partners in plain terms
  • Reconcile data to the source and flag discrepancies before finalizing reports.
  • Experience with an ERP system (e.g., NetSuite, SAP, Oracle, and Workday)
  • Build models and resolve data problems using Excel and Analytics tools.
  • Identify process gaps and propose improvements to existing reporting or workflows
  • 0–2 years of experience in finance, accounting, or analytics
  • Proficiency using AI tools (e.g., Claude, ChatGPT) to support analysis

Compensation: 65,000-80,000 USD
